In this charming midsummer comedy from Angela Thirkell's classic 1930's Barsetshire series, Oxford student Richard Tebben is won over by the spirited Dean family. It is August in the Barsetshire village of Worsted, and Richard Tebben, just down from Oxford, is considering the miserable outlook of a long summer in the parental home. But the glamorous Dean family-exquisite Rachel, her accomplished husband, and six of their nine bright children-have come for the holidays, and their hostess Mrs. Palmer plans to get everyone into performing in her disastrous annual Greek play. Encircled by the likable, irrepressible Deans, Richard and his sister Margaret cannot help but have their minds opened, their emotional state raised, and hearts taken.
